Joseph Barnes

Joseph William Barnes Jr., 85, of Highland, IL, born Sunday, October 22, 1939, in Los Angeles, CA, passed away Saturday, May 17, 2025, at Barnes-Jewish Hospital in St. Louis, MO.

Joe graduated from Belleville Township High School in 1958. There, he was a proud member of the golf and diving teams, as well as the Sports Car Club, Golf Club, Letterman, and Prom Committee. After graduation, he attended college in Florida and then returned to the St. Louis metro area to work with his father in construction. He was a Staff Sergeant in the 52 Medical Service Squadron of the U.S. Air Force Reserves from 1962 to 1968.

In 1974, he married his bride, Linda, and moved to Highland after designing and building their A-frame home with his father. There, they built their lives and raised two daughters. Joe worked as a Project Manager for Interior Construction Services in St. Louis until his retirement.

He was a member of St. Clair Lodge #24 A.F & A.M. in Belleville, IL, Scottish Rite Bodies where he received his 33° in 1982, Ainad Shrine where he served as President of the Arab Patrol Club in 1970 and Potentate in 1985, Southern Illinois Court #86 R.O.J. (Past Director 1973), and Elks Lodge #664 in Fairview Heights, IL.

Honest, hardworking, witty, and loving, Joe was a devoted husband and father. He had a passion for golf, whether it was on the course with friends or playing mini golf with his wife, children, and grandsons. He adored watching sports on TV, especially with his grandson, Cole, sharing countless hours of games and conversation. He loved playing games with his family, especially Telestrations, which always brought plenty of laughter.

He and his beloved wife, Linda, shared many joys in life, including their season tickets to the Muny, where they loved seeing shows together. They also cherished traveling to Branson with their dearest friends and family to take in performances. Together, they enjoyed trips to Las Vegas, regular visits to Texas to see their younger daughter and grandsons, and adventures across the country with their older daughter, creating treasured memories.
